直观地浏览JACKRABBIT内容?

时间:2011-08-23 14:22:48

标签: java apache jackrabbit jcr jsr170

我想从我的DataBase表中删除当前内容。

并将它们带到内容存储库(JCR)

是否有任何向导可以直观地浏览Jackrabbit内容。

因为使用长耳大野兔并因为运行简单命令而浪费时间真的很无聊。

5 个答案:

答案 0 :(得分:3)

我找到了Toromiro,但我不知道我用命令创建它的节点在哪里。

Toromiro

答案 1 :(得分:1)

您可以尝试JCR Explorer。该项目自2007年以来没有发布,但我用它来访问Jackrabbit 1.x存储库没有问题。

答案 2 :(得分:1)

我不知道有哪些好的图形工具可以与最近的长耳兔版本配合使用。但是我发现独立的CLI客户端非常强大,因为它允许您轻松地执行所有简单命令并且也可以编写脚本。 如果您使用jackrabbit的独立服务器,您可以通过davex(推荐)

连接
java -jar jackrabbit-standalone-2.2.7.jar  --cli http://localhost:8080/server

或通过RMI

java -jar jackrabbit-standalone-2.2.7.jar  --cli rmi://localhost:1099/rmi

E.g。创建新节点就像发布

一样简单
addnode "test"

使用unix命令浏览存储库:cd,ls以及lsprop以列出属性值。

对于客户端运行中可用的所有命令

help

答案 3 :(得分:1)

对于独立的Jackrabbit,可以使用任何http浏览器浏览存储库内容。 例如,如果我在端口8087上运行独立JR:

http://localhost:8087/repository/default/

这里“默认”是工作空间名称,访问任何其他工作空间只需用工作空间名称替换它。 当然,它是只读的,没有任何很酷的功能,但它是捆绑的,可以浏览存储库内容,而无需安装任何其他工具。

答案 4 :(得分:1)

我喜欢Jackrabbit Explorer,因为它有一个允许“树”式浏览的GWT界面,它也可以使用XPath进行搜索。唯一的缺点是它似乎不支持版本化节点(它无法打开它们)